Output 39f60b8def883b4ac80f4e1de26ca722cb4e153088cdc4863fe10dad224fb815:0

value
519887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2b51dd4698f1fa0b79af17dc48d6d9ebcbc3e2b OP_EQUAL
address
3KSXyxNNyHc593VMvan7eCPUoWPKDB8W5g
transaction
39f60b8def883b4ac80f4e1de26ca722cb4e153088cdc4863fe10dad224fb815
confirmations
270948
spent
true